2. System Configuration
High-speed cutting (G05) can be achieved using three below cases. Fig.2-1 shows a system configuration.
(1) Memory operation by “High speed cycle cutting”
a) To produce cutting data by Open CNC or personal computer and down load to P-code area of CNC.
b) To produce cutting data by Macro executor and write to P-code area.
After preparing the cutting data by Personal Computer or Open CNC.
(2) Data Server operation with High-speed binary operation.
c)To produce cutting data by Open CNC or personal computer and down load via Ethernet to Data server
and run “High speed binary operation by Data Server”.
(3) DNC operation that Open CNC or Personal compute run directly CNC through HSSB
using the next two ways.
(d) User’s program including DNC operation library.
(e) DNC operation management package in BOP (Basic Operation Package).
(Note) In case of (3) , there is a possibility that transmission rate can not keep always due to the personal
computer performance. In individual case, consult with Software technique department. If you
need to have the transmission rate guaranteed, you must select the method of c) .
♦ You can choose the Memory operation or (either Data Server operation or DNC operation) in one
system. You can change two operations by G05 code or M198 code in your cutting program.
♦
In case of Memory operation, you can use “High speed cycle skip function” or “High speed cycle
retract function”. In case of (2) or (3), you can use “High speed binary retract function”, can not use
“High speed binary skip function”.
(Note) In case that you store Learning data and recycle it, refer to 7.2 Learning data transmission function.
